2. France: Southern Charm in the Proven?al Countryside

Southern France, especially the Proven?al region, is renowned for its picturesque landscapes and rich cultural heritage. The lavender fields of Provence offer a captivating view, while the vineyards of the Rh?ne Valley provide another stunning backdrop. Enjoy a lifestyle filled with sunshine, olive groves, and rustic charm. The region's warm climate and vibrant community make it an excellent choice for those seeking a charming countryside retreat.

3. Switzerland: Alpine Wilderness and Mountain Views

Switzerland offers a unique combination of alpine wilderness and mountain beauty. Regions such as Valais and Engadin provide breathtaking scenery, with snow-capped peaks, picturesque villages, and serene lakes. The country's strict rules on preserving the natural environment ensure that the landscape remains pristine and unspoiled. This makes Switzerland an ideal destination for those who appreciate the peace and solitude of the countryside.
